ANTONIO CORTIS (12 August 1891 — 2 April 1952) was a Spanish tenor with an outstanding voice. He was acclaimed by audiences on both sides of the Atlantic for his exciting performances of Italian operatic works, especially those by Giuseppe Verdi, Giacomo Puccini and the verismo composers.

That is how the high note was written in the score. Cortis clearly could have held it longer. But he made this recording, if memory serves, in the late 1920s or early 30s, not long after "Turandot's" premiere. So no tradition had yet been established for tenors singing Calaf to sustain that top tone fermata --
